Output 38f73502a99a71b8213de3bbd23888231adf9432aa74ae3a87fc4fb75d509173:3

value
144480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6dd01ad62b0105d2674606e5215ad9853eb4344 OP_EQUAL
address
3GuJrC6FzVNAEJrudnVjwEpW4m5maCesJT
transaction
38f73502a99a71b8213de3bbd23888231adf9432aa74ae3a87fc4fb75d509173
spent
true